There are no fees payable until you buy and no upfront fees.
When you buy your new home, our fees usually range between 1-2% of the purchase price. (plus GST) depending on the services you require.
There are many ways in which we can save you money – strategy, and timing are two examples. Ensuring you don’t buy the wrong home – stamp duty alone is usually 5.5 per cent of the purchase price. A property that is not advertised publicly (i.e. on the internet, via the newspaper or with a sales board). As a buyer, if the property suits your needs, you need to ask the right questions of the owner/selling agent, as a lot of time, energy and resources can be wasted in trying to buy an off-market home. We can help with this, and provide a buying opportunity that otherwise would not have been available.
Privacy, no upfront expenses (i.e. advertising), timing (i.e. not tied into school holidays), less stress, less preparation needed on the house to make it ready for sale and these are only some of the reasons.
